Iran’s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ei has reportedly drawn up contingency plans in case he is targeted in a possible US or Israeli strike, according to a New York Times report. The plans include naming layers of successors and delegating decision-making powers to a small inner circle if communications are disrupted. Longtime loyalist Ali Larijani is said to be overseeing key state affairs during the crisis. The developments come as US President Donald Trump weighs military options and pushes Tehran to reach a nuclear deal. With Geneva talks resuming, tensions remain high amid fears over Iran’s nuclear programme and continued domestic unrest.
